Arrow Head Plant Care for Growing a Beautiful Syngonium

Arrow Head Plant, also known as Syngonium or Arrowhead Vine, is a popular Araceae family houseplant. This lovely plant is known for its arrow-shaped leaves and is widely used as an ornamental plant in homes and offices. If you want to grow an Arrow Head Plant or if you already have one, this article will give you all the information you need to keep it healthy and thriving.

Arrow Head Plant Varieties


Arrow Head Plant comes in a variety of colors and patterns on its leaves. Syngonium podophyllum, Syngonium pink, and Pink Arrowhead Plant are among the most popular varieties. These varieties have distinguishing characteristics that set them apart from one another.

Syngonium Podophyllum, also known as Goosefoot Plant, has bright green leaves that are arrow-shaped and can grow to be 7 inches long. This variety is simple to grow and requires little attention.

Pink Allusion, also known as Syngonium Pink, has pinkish leaves that can turn a deep red color when exposed to bright light. This variety is more difficult to care for than the others because it requires more humidity and a well-draining soil.

Pink Arrowhead Plant, also known as Neon Robusta, has light green leaves with pink veins that can reach a length of 6 inches. This variety is simple to care for and can tolerate low light levels.

Arrow Head Plant Care


The Arrow Head Plant requires little care and can thrive in a variety of environments. Here are some pointers to keep your Arrow Head Plant looking good and healthy:

1. Light: The Arrow Head Plant prefers indirect, bright light. Direct sunlight can scorch its leaves, while insufficient light can slow its growth.
2. Watering: The Arrow Head Plant prefers to be kept evenly moist but not wet. When the top inch of soil feels dry to the touch, water it. Overwatering can result in root rot, which is fatal to the plant.
3. Arrow Head Plant prefers high humidity. By misting the leaves with water or placing a humidifier near the plant, you can increase humidity.
4. Fertilizer: To grow healthy and strong, the Arrow Head Plant requires regular fertilization. During the growing season, apply a balanced fertilizer every two weeks (spring and summer).
5. Pruning: To control the size and shape of the Arrow Head Plant, prune it.
Pruning can also be used to remove any yellow or dead leaves.

Propagation of Arrowhead Plants


Stem cuttings can be used to propagate the Arrow Head Plant. Here's how it's done:

1. Select a stem cutting with at least two leaves and a node (where the leaf attaches to the stem).
2. Dip the cutting end in rooting hormone.
3. Plant the cutting in a moist soil-filled pot.
4. To make a mini greenhouse, cover the pot with a plastic bag.
5. Maintain moist soil and place the cutting in bright, indirect light.
6. The cutting should begin to root after a few weeks. Remove the plastic bag after it has rooted and care for the new plant as you would a mature Arrow Head Plant.
